Germany - Mining Support Service Hours Worked
Since 2014, Germany Mining Support Service Hours Worked fell by 8.9%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 7 comparing other countries in Mining Support Service Hours Worked with 3,202,562 Hours. Germany is overtaken by Croatia, which was number 6 at 3,274,158 Hours and is followed by Czech Republic with 2,996,284 Hours. Norway ranked the highest with 48,778,001.69 Hours in 2019, a decrease of 1.7% versus 2018. United Kingdom, Poland and Romania resp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Spain recorded the best 5 years average growth at +34% per year, while Latvia was the worst growing country at -27.5% per year.
